What is the typical cost of preschool in Elfers, FL, and are there any local financial assistance programs?

In Elfers, monthly preschool tuition typically ranges from $600 to $1,200, depending on the program's hours, curriculum, and facilities. For financial assistance, Florida's School Readiness Program offers income-based subsidies, and you can apply through the Early Learning Coalition of Pasco and Hernando Counties, which serves this area. Some local preschools may also offer sibling discounts or scholarship opportunities.

How do I verify the quality and licensing of a preschool in Elfers?

All licensed preschools in Florida are regulated by the Department of Children and Families (DCF). You can search for a specific provider's licensing history and any reported violations on the DCF website. Additionally, look for programs accredited by national bodies like the National Association for the Education of Young Children (NAEYC) or those with a Gold Seal Quality Care designation from the state, which indicates higher standards.

What are the common preschool schedule options available in Elfers?

Preschools in Elfers typically offer part-time (e.g., 3 half-days a week), full-time (5 full days), and extended care options to accommodate working parents. Many centers align with the Pasco County school calendar, but some private programs operate year-round. It's important to inquire about specific hours, as Florida's Voluntary Prekindergarten (VPK) program only covers 3 hours of instructional time per day.

Are there specific considerations for preschool curriculum or focus in Elfers?

Many Elfers preschools incorporate Florida's Early Learning and Developmental Standards. A key local program is the state-funded Voluntary Prekindergarten (VPK), which focuses on school readiness skills. You'll also find programs with various educational approaches, from play-based to more structured academic curricula. Given the coastal Florida environment, some schools may integrate nature and science themes relevant to the local ecosystem.

What is the enrollment process and timeline for preschools in Elfers, especially for the VPK program?

For the free VPK program, you must first obtain a Certificate of Eligibility from the Early Learning Coalition after proving Florida residency and your child's age (4 years old by Sept. 1). General enrollment for most preschools in Elfers begins in early spring for the fall term, but popular programs fill quickly. It's advisable to schedule tours and apply several months in advance, and many private programs have rolling admission if space is available.

When beginning your search, it's helpful to understand what sets private Pre-K programs apart. These schools often offer smaller class sizes, which means more individualized attention for your child. This can be invaluable for developing early literacy and numeracy skills at a pace that suits your child's unique learning style. Many private programs also incorporate specialized curricula, such as Montessori, faith-based learning, or play-based developmental models, allowing you to choose an environment that aligns with your family's values and your child's personality.

As you explore private pre k schools in and around Elfers, consider scheduling tours and visits. This is the best way to get a true feel for the environment. Pay close attention to the classrooms: Are they bright, organized, and filled with engaging materials? Observe how the teachers interact with the children; you want to see warm, patient educators who are down on the child’s level, facilitating learning through conversation and guided play. Don't hesitate to ask about the daily schedule, the balance between structured activities and free play, and how social-emotional skills—like sharing, empathy, and problem-solving—are nurtured throughout the day.

Another key factor is the school's philosophy on communication. A strong partnership between parents and teachers is essential. Inquire about how the school keeps you informed about your child's progress, whether through daily reports, regular parent-teacher conferences, or a dedicated app. This connection ensures you are a partner in your child's education. Also, consider practicalities like safety protocols, the security of the facility, and the outdoor play space. A safe, stimulating playground is a cornerstone of a good Pre-K program, offering vital opportunities for physical development and imaginative play.
